Computation offloading for object-oriented applications in a UAV-based edge-cloud environment

被引:4
|
作者
Zhang, Jianshan [1 ,2 ]
Li, Ming [1 ,2 ]
Chen, Zheyi [3 ]
Lin, Bing [4 ]
机构
[1] Fuzhou Univ, Coll Math & Comp Sci, Fuzhou, Peoples R China
[2] Fujian Prov Key Lab Network Comp & Intelligent In, Fuzhou, Peoples R China
[3] Univ Exeter, Coll Engn Math & Phys Sci, Dept Comp Sci, Exeter, Devon, England
[4] Fujian Normal Univ, Coll Phys & Energy, Fuzhou, Peoples R China
来源
JOURNAL OF SUPERCOMPUTING | 2022年 / 78卷 / 08期
基金
中国国家自然科学基金;
关键词
Mobile edge computing; Computation offloading; Task scheduling; Object-oriented applications; UAV; JOINT OPTIMIZATION; ENERGY; ALLOCATION; RESOURCE;
D O I
10.1007/s11227-021-04288-0
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
The high mobility and maneuverability of unmanned aerial vehicles (UAVs) enable them to act as temporary base stations (BSs) in extreme environments, expanding the computing capacities of terminals for intelligent applications, most of which are object-oriented ones. Computation offloading in a UAV-based edge-cloud environment is an excellent way to improve the performance of these object-oriented intelligent applications. In contrast, the computation-intensive tasks are offloaded to the cloud, and the data-intensive ones are offloaded to the edge. Though computation offloading over the cloud, edge, and terminals has been broadly studied, existing researches primarily establish scheduling algorithms on program high-level abstraction without consideration of challenges from program structures. We focus on task scheduling for offloading object-oriented applications while considering the 'encapsulation' characteristic. We proposed a time-driven offloading strategy based on a particle swarm optimization algorithm employing the genetic algorithm operators with floating encoding (PGFE). This strategy introduces a genetic algorithm's randomly two-point crossover and mutation operator to avoid converging on local optima effectively. The simulation results show that our strategy can reduce the average execution time of object-oriented applications by 11.78-48.02%, compared with other classic algorithms in a UAV-based edge-cloud environment.
引用
收藏
页码:10829 / 10853
页数:25
相关论文
共 50 条
  • [1] Computation offloading for object-oriented applications in a UAV-based edge-cloud environment
    Jianshan Zhang
    Ming Li
    Zheyi Chen
    Bing Lin
    [J]. The Journal of Supercomputing, 2022, 78 : 10829 - 10853
  • [2] A metaheuristic-based computation offloading in edge-cloud environment
    Ali Shahidinejad
    Mostafa Ghobaei-Arani
    [J]. Journal of Ambient Intelligence and Humanized Computing, 2022, 13 : 2785 - 2794
  • [3] A metaheuristic-based computation offloading in edge-cloud environment
    Shahidinejad, Ali
    Ghobaei-Arani, Mostafa
    [J]. JOURNAL OF AMBIENT INTELLIGENCE AND HUMANIZED COMPUTING, 2021, 13 (5) : 2785 - 2794
  • [4] Online Computation Offloading and Traffic Routing for UAV Swarms in Edge-Cloud Computing
    Liu, Baichuan
    Zhang, Weikun
    Chen, Wuhui
    Huang, Huawei
    Guo, Song
    [J]. IEEE TRANSACTIONS ON VEHICULAR TECHNOLOGY, 2020, 69 (08) : 8777 - 8791
  • [5] Algorithmics of Cost-Driven Computation Offloading in the Edge-Cloud Environment
    Du, Mingzhe
    Wang, Yang
    Ye, Kejiang
    Xu, Chengzhong
    [J]. IEEE TRANSACTIONS ON COMPUTERS, 2020, 69 (10) : 1519 - 1532
  • [6] Cost Efficient Offloading Strategy for DNN-based Applications in Edge-Cloud Environment
    Huang, Yinhao
    Lin, Bing
    Zheng, Yongjie
    Hu, Junqin
    Mo, Yuchang
    Chen, Xing
    [J]. 2019 IEEE INTL CONF ON PARALLEL & DISTRIBUTED PROCESSING WITH APPLICATIONS, BIG DATA & CLOUD COMPUTING, SUSTAINABLE COMPUTING & COMMUNICATIONS, SOCIAL COMPUTING & NETWORKING (ISPA/BDCLOUD/SOCIALCOM/SUSTAINCOM 2019), 2019, : 331 - 337
  • [7] Efficient Computation Offloading for Edge-cloud Collaborative Networks
    Yu, Bocheng
    Zhang, Xingjun
    Wang, Juzhen
    Lei, Ming
    [J]. 2021 IEEE 94TH VEHICULAR TECHNOLOGY CONFERENCE (VTC2021-FALL), 2021,
  • [8] Edge-Cloud Collaborative Computation Offloading for Mixed Traffic
    Li, Qirui
    Guo, Mian
    Peng, Zhiping
    Cui, Delong
    He, Jieguang
    [J]. IEEE SYSTEMS JOURNAL, 2023, 17 (03): : 5023 - 5034
  • [9] Integrated Computation Offloading, UAV Trajectory Control, Edge-Cloud and Radio Resource Allocation in SAGIN
    Nguyen, Minh Dat
    Le, Long Bao
    Girard, Andre
    [J]. IEEE TRANSACTIONS ON CLOUD COMPUTING, 2024, 12 (01) : 100 - 115
  • [10] Collaborative Optimization of Edge-Cloud Computation Offloading in Internet of Vehicles
    Li, Yureng
    Xu, Shouzhi
    [J]. 30TH INTERNATIONAL CONFERENCE ON COMPUTER COMMUNICATIONS AND NETWORKS (ICCCN 2021), 2021,